Authorities in Thoubal district on Thursday carried out a major eviction to remove illegal encroachments on government land, as part of a statewide initiative across Manipur.
The eviction was supervised by Deputy Commissioner Hannah Khamei in coordination with the Police Department and Thoubal Municipal Council. Teams from the Revenue Department and other line agencies dismantled unauthorized structures in multiple locations identified during prior surveys.
Khamei, who inspected the sites, said residents had been notified of the action through a public notice issued on July 22, 2025. She urged people to cooperate with the administration, adding that the reclaimed plots would be used for upcoming public infrastructure and civic projects.
The Thoubal eviction forms part of a broader campaign taking place in other districts, including Imphal West, Imphal East, Bishnupur, and Kangpokpi. However, Thursday’s focus remained on clearing government land in Thoubal to facilitate planned development in the district.
